Kyiv, September 24 (PolitNavigator, Victoria Litovchenko) – President of Ukraine Petro Poroshenko instructed the Minister of Defense of Ukraine Valeriy Geletey to send military commissars to the ATO zone.

According to the presidential press service, this is stated in the order of the head of state.

The document mandates that military commissars of districts, cities, and regions be sent to the anti-terrorist operation zone for military service. At the same time, according to the decree, military personnel participating in the anti-terrorist operation who were wounded or otherwise damaged, but who were recognized by military medical commissions as fit for health reasons for military service, can be appointed to the positions of military commissars.

As PolitNavigator reported, previously, relatives of military personnel have repeatedly demanded that military commissars be sent to the ATO zone.
